recounting

/rɪˈkaʊntɪŋ/
noun
  1. The act of telling a story or describing an event.
    • We sat around the campfire, listening to the recounting of old legends.
    • Her recounting of the incident was both accurate and emotional.
    • The recounting of his journey took over an hour.
  2. The act of counting something again, especially votes.
    • The recounting process was monitored by observers from both parties.
    • The recounting of the ballots lasted late into the night.
    • After the recounting, the results remained unchanged.
